Lessons Learned from NASA Goddard Space Flight Center’s Product Development Lead Training Schedule and Cost Development Workshop: Continuous Improvement This presentation provides a status of the Goddard Space Flight Center (GSFC) effort to increase foundational knowledge of Product Development Leads (PDLs) in schedule and cost management including earned value management (EVM).

In 2012, GSFC’s Engineering and Technology Directorate (ETD) implemented an in-house training program to prepare PDLs for managing the technical, cost, schedule, and risk aspects of spaceflight systems to meet their subsystem commitments. Developed in-house, the PDL training program provides an integrated approach to requirements development, risk, schedule and cost management, EVM, performance tracking, and other areas.

The program has been held twice yearly since its inception with 531 participating and 451 completing the curriculum. In 2017, the program won the Robert H. Goddard award for Quality and Process Improvement.

Program development and evolution were presented in the 2018 NASA Schedule and Cost Symposium. The presentation was so well received that this year we focus on one workshop within the program: Schedule and Cost Development, including EVM. We examine the on-going logic modeling process and how participant and stakeholder data influence workshop content and design, and how the disciplines of schedule and cost contribute to mission success.

In this presentation we refresh you on how the approach integrates lecture, small group discussion, estimating, case study exercises, and problem solving. We update you on the data collected from participants and stakeholders, and we discuss how we use these data to measure training effectiveness.

Specific topics include:
• How the logic model is used as the backbone for continuous program improvement,
• How feedback influences implementation and curriculum updates,
• How data collection and analysis inform workshop content and development, including participant discoveries of EVM data,
• How including the resource analyst and planner in the product development team supports project success.
